E376667BC6895DE795D9EF79C43A28CC.taxon	description	Description. Pileus 3.6 – 6.2 cm in diameter, 0.2 – 0.3 cm thick at the center, truncate conical to plane, surface dry, white (5 A 1) or orange white (5 A 2), covered with scattered arranged orange (5 A 8), brownish yellow (5 C 8) fibrillose squamules, denser at disc, showing brownish orange (6 C 8) or brown (6 E 8), margin appendiculate by annulus remnants. Context of the pileus white (6 A 1), with no special odor. Lamellae 0.2 – 0.4 cm broad, pastel red (9 A 4) then reddish brown (8 E 8) later brownish black (8 F 8), free, crowded, intercalated with numerous lamellulae. Stipe 5.6 – 8.6 × 0.4 – 1.3 cm, hollow, clavate, with white (6 A 1) rhizomorphs, provided with an annulus in its upper third, above the annulus white (6 A 1), below the annulus with white (6 A 1), orange (5 A 8) floccose squamules, becoming dark yellow (4 C 8) on touching or bruising. Annulus superior, white (6 A 1), simple, membranous, easy falling out. Basidiospores (4.6) 4.7 – 5.7 (5.9) × (2.7) 2.8 – 3.3 (3.6) μm, [Xav = 5.2 × 3.1 μm], Q = 1.50 – 1.93, Qav = 1.70, ellipsoid to elongate-ellipsoid, smooth, thick-walled, brown, guttulate. Basidia 14 – 18 × 5 – 7 μm, clavate, 4 (2) - spored, sterigmata 2 – 4 µm long. Cheilocystidia abundant, nearly globose, oblong, sphaeropedunculate, or broadly clavate, 12 – 34 × 10 – 20 μm, with pale yellowish intracellular pigment. Pleurocystidia absent. Pileipellis a cutis of cylindrical, slightly constricted at the septa, pale yellowish hyphae, 4 – 9 μm in diameter.	en	Wang, Shi-en, Chen, Si-ang, Huang, Hai-chen, Lin, Dong-mei, Liu, Peng-hu (2025): Three new species of Agaricus (Agaricaceae, Agaricales) from southern China. 5F9C3FAFFE6A578FA0225F090B7BFB5A.taxon	description	Description. Pileus 3.4 – 5.5 cm in diameter, 0.2 – 0.4 cm thick at the center, truncate conical to plane, surface dry, white (5 A 1), brownish gray (7 C 2), covered with brown (7 D 5) or fox red (8 D 7) fibrils or with fibrillose squamules, concentrically arranged, denser and reddish brown (8 E 8) at disc, margin appendiculate by annulus remnants. Context of the pileus, white (6 A 1), with no special odor. Lamellae 0.2 – 0.3 cm broad, first pastel red (9 A 4), then reddish brown (8 E 8), later brownish black (8 F 8), free, crowded, intercalated with numerous lamellulae. Stipe 2.2 – 4.5 × 0.6 – 1.5 cm, nearly cylindrical, hollow, with white (6 A 1) rhizomorphs, provided with an annulus in its upper half, above the annulus white (6 A 1), below the annulus covered towards the base with concolorous squamules with the pileus surface. Annulus superior, white (6 A 1) to reddish brown (8 E 8), simple, membranous, persistent. Basidiospores (5.7) 6.0 – 7.9 (8.2) × (3.5) 3.7 – 5.0 (5.1) μm, [Xav = 6.8 × 4.2 μm], Q = 1.46 – 2.03, Qav = 1.63, ellipsoid to cylindrical, smooth, thick-walled, brown, guttulate. Basidia 17 – 25 × 6 – 9 μm, clavate, 4 (2) - spored, sterigmata 1 – 3 µm long. Cheilocystidia abundant, nearly globose, broadly clavate, or pyriform, 10 – 23 × 7 – 13 μm, hyaline. Pleurocystidia absent. Pileipellis a cutis of cylindrical, slightly constricted at septa, light brown hyphae, 6 – 12 μm wide.	en	Wang, Shi-en, Chen, Si-ang, Huang, Hai-chen, Lin, Dong-mei, Liu, Peng-hu (2025): Three new species of Agaricus (Agaricaceae, Agaricales) from southern China. 9957CD289E14588FA514BE678DB58C09.taxon	diagnosis	Diagnosis. Distinguished by the pileus adorned with brownish gray (6 E 2) fibrillose squamules, context becoming yellow (3 B 8) on cutting, stipe base tapering and covered with brownish gray (6 E 2) fibrillose squamules, predominantly 2 - spored basidia.	en	Wang, Shi-en, Chen, Si-ang, Huang, Hai-chen, Lin, Dong-mei, Liu, Peng-hu (2025): Three new species of Agaricus (Agaricaceae, Agaricales) from southern China. 9957CD289E14588FA514BE678DB58C09.taxon	description	Description. Pileus 2.5 – 6.5 cm in diameter, 0.5 – 0.8 cm thick at the center, hemispherical, truncate conical to plane, applanate with a slightly depressed center when mature, surface dry, white (2 A 1), grayish white (2 B 1), entirely covered with appressed, concentrically arranged, triangular, brownish gray (6 E 2) fibrillose squamules, scattered towards the margin in age, denser taupe (4 F 1), black (2 F 1) at the disc, margin entire, appendiculate by annulus remnants. Context of the pileus white (6 A 1), becoming yellow (3 B 8) on cutting, odor unknown. Lamellae 0.5 – 0.7 cm broad, first pale red (9 A 3) then reddish brown (8 E 8), later brownish black (8 F 8), free, crowded, intercalated with numerous lamellulae. Stipe 4.5 – 11.5 × 0.5 – 2.0 cm, cylindrical, tapering downwards, hollow, with short white (6 A 1) rhizomorphs, provided with an annulus in its upper part, above the annulus white (6 A 1), below the annulus the upper half white and the lower half covered with dense adpressed brownish grey (6 E 2) squamules concolorous with the pileus surface. Annulus superior, white (6 A 1) to brownish black (8 F 8), simple, membranous, persistent. Basidiospores (5.8) 6.1 – 7.3 (7.5) × (3.8) 4.0 – 4.3 (4.4) μm, [Xav = 6.8 × 4.2 μm], Q = 1.41 – 1.87, Qav = 1.61, ellipsoid to elongate-ellipsoid, smooth, brown, thick-walled, guttulate. Basidia 25 – 33 × 8 – 10 μm, clavate, 2 (4) - spored, sterigmata 2 – 3 µm long. Cheilocystidia abundant, broadly clavate, oblong or pyriform, 22 – 50 × 10 – 22 μm. Pleurocystidia absent. Pileipellis a cutis of cylindrical, slightly constricted at the septa, light brown hyphae, 4 – 7 μm wide.	en	Wang, Shi-en, Chen, Si-ang, Huang, Hai-chen, Lin, Dong-mei, Liu, Peng-hu (2025): Three new species of Agaricus (Agaricaceae, Agaricales) from southern China.
